It is also interesting to look at before and after FSK signals in the time
domain.
https://picasaweb.google.com/StarrGarretson/2013_03_25_K3_FSK
K3 FSK has always had a small amplitude difference between mark and space.
The transition has always been abrupt, Photo 1. With the new beta software,
the transition is much more gentle, Photo 2. Bravo!
